Snow Squall Warning issued January 15 at 7:45AM EST until January 15 at 8:45AM EST by NWS Charleston WV
The National Weather Service in Charleston West Virginia has issued a * Snow Squall Warning for...
Southwestern Meigs County in southeastern Ohio...
Gallia County in southeastern Ohio...
Jackson County in southeastern Ohio...
Southern Vinton County in southeastern Ohio...
Mason County in western West Virginia...
Northern Putnam County in western West Virginia...
Northeastern Kanawha County in central West Virginia...
Southwestern Roane County in central West Virginia...
Southern Jackson County in northwestern West Virginia...

* Until 845 AM EST.

* At 744 AM EST, a dangerous snow squall was located along a line extending from near Jackson to 6 miles northwest of Buffalo to near Amma, and is nearly stationary.
HAZARD...Intense bursts of heavy snow. Gusty winds leading to blowing snow and visibility rapidly falling to less than one-quarter mile. Wind gusts up to 35 mph.
SOURCE...Radar indicated.
IMPACT...Travel will become difficult and potentially dangerous within minutes.
This includes the following highways...
Interstate 79 between mile markers 4 and 28.
Interstate 77 in West Virginia between mile markers 108 and 141.
Locations impacted include...
Jackson, Wellston, Point Pleasant, Gallipolis, Ripley, Winfield, Oak Hill, Rio Grande, Sissonville, Eleanor, Buffalo, Clendenin, Kenna, Elkview, Amma, Pinch, Gallia, Middleport, Bancroft, and Coalton.
